Price for Cereal Grains; Rolled or Flaked, of Cereals Excluding Barley and Oats in Colombia (CIF) - 2022
In 2022, the average import price for cereal grains; rolled or flaked, of cereals excluding barley and oatses amounted to $1,396 per ton, falling by -6.8% against the previous year. Over the period under review, import price indicated moderate growth from 2012 to 2022: its price increased at an average annual rate of +2.6% over the last decade.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2022 figures, import price for cereal grains; rolled or flaked, of cereals excluding barley and oatses increased by +74.4% against 2020 indices.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 when the average import price increased by 87%. Over the period under review, average import prices reached the maximum at $1,948 per ton in 2015; however, from 2016 to 2022, import prices failed to regain momentum.
Prices varied noticeably by country of origin: am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Bolivia ($9,176 per ton), while the price for Germany ($514 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Belgium (+10.2%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Price for Cereal Grains; Rolled or Flaked, of Cereals Excluding Barley and Oats in Colombia (FOB) - 2022
The average export price for cereal grains; rolled or flaked, of cereals excluding barley and oatses stood at $1,246 per ton in 2022, shrinking by -21.1% against the previous year. In general, the export price saw a deep setback.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2021 an increase of 18%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the average export prices hit record highs at $2,440 per ton in 2013; however, from 2014 to 2022, the export prices failed to regain momentum.
Prices varied noticeably by country of destination: am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Switzerland ($2,500 per ton), while the average price for exports to Australia ($1,215 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Spain (+1.9%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ced a decline.
Imports of Cereal Grains; Rolled or Flaked, of Cereals Excluding Barley and Oats in Colombia
Imports of cereal grains; rolled or flaked, of cereals excluding barley and oatses into Colombia was estimated at 41 tons in 2022, increasing by 7.9% on 2021 figures. Over the period under review, imports, however, saw a noticeable contraction.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 32% against the previous year.
In value terms, imports of cereal grains; rolled or flaked, of cereals excluding barley and oatses amounted to $57K in 2022. In general, imports, however, showed a abrupt shrinkage.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2021 with an increase of 148%.
Import of Cereal Grains; Rolled or Flaked, of Cereals Excluding Barley and Oats in Colombia (Thousand US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
United Kingdom | N/A | N/A | N/A | 19.4 | 0% |
Brazil | 17.0 | 10.2 | 20.2 | 13.8 | -6.7% |
United States | 23.3 | 4.8 | 20.8 | 11.6 | -20.7% |
Belgium | 6.3 | 2.1 | 5.4 | 4.4 | -11.3% |
Bolivia | 31.8 | 4.1 | 5.9 | 4.2 | -49.1% |
Canada | 1.0 | 0.6 | 1.8 | 3.1 | 45.8% |
Germany | 2.2 | 1.0 | 1.6 | 0.8 | -28.6% |
Others | N/A | 0.3 | 1.5 | 0.1 | -42.3% |
Total | 81.6 | 23.1 | 57.1 | 57.5 | -11.0% |
Top Suppliers of Cereal Grains; Rolled or Flaked, of Cereals Excluding Barley and Oats to Colombia in 2022:
- United Kingdom (20.9 tons)
- Brazil (10.8 tons)
- United States (3.3 tons)
- Belgium (3.2 tons)
- Germany (1.6 tons)
- Canada (0.8 tons)
- Bolivia (0.5 tons)
Exports of Cereal Grains; Rolled or Flaked, of Cereals Excluding Barley and Oats in Colombia
In 2022, approx. 2.3 tons of cereal grains; rolled or flaked, of cereals excluding barley and oatses were exported from Colombia; rising by 492% against the year before. Over the period under review, exports enjoyed a significant increase. As a result, the exports attained the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
In value terms, exports of cereal grains; rolled or flaked, of cereals excluding barley and oatses soared to $2.9K in 2022. In general, exports saw a significant expansion. As a result, the exports reached the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
Export of Cereal Grains; Rolled or Flaked, of Cereals Excluding Barley and Oats in Colombia (US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
Romania | N/A | N/A | N/A | 1,738 | 0% |
Spain | 421 | 224 | 163 | 460 | 3.0% |
Australia | 154 | 87.0 | 364 | 440 | 41.9% |
Canada | 10.0 | 9.0 | 60.0 | 212 | 176.8% |
Aruba | 10.0 | 5.0 | 15.0 | 7.0 | -11.2% |
Saudi Arabia | 242 | N/A | N/A | N/A | 0% |
Others | 4.0 | 11.0 | 11.0 | 5.0 | 7.7% |
Total | 841 | 336 | 613 | 2,862 | 50.4% |
Top Export Markets for Cereal Grains; Rolled or Flaked, of Cereals Excluding Barley and Oats from Colombia in 2022:
- Romania (1430.0 kg)
- Australia (362.0 kg)
- Spain (350.0 kg)
- Canada (144.0 kg)
- Aruba (9.0 kg)
